4.2.5 Glide Amoebae
The Glide Amoebae (plural form of Glide Amoeba) are powerful graphical display items which make it
obvious at a glance how far you can glide in any direction. Any airport or field that is inside the Glide
Amoebae is within glide range. There are 2 Glide Amoebae displayed on the map. The arrival altitudes
for each Glide Amoeba are adjustable. There is also an optional
MSL Altitude Glide Ring
which is
described in the next section.
Example showing the Glide Amoebae in mountainous terrain
As you can see in the image above the Glide Amoebae can take on strange “amoeba‐like” shapes when
flying in mountainous terrain. The purple Glide Amoeba has a flat spot on the top left side where a
mountain ridge is located. The points where the Glide Amoeba shoots out (such as at the left side) is
where there is a mountain pass that can be glided though and on into the valley beyond.
